The Hidden Costs of Non-Compliant Storage
Three critical pain points dominate offshore operations:
- Accelerated corrosion (2.5x faster than onshore installations)
- Electromagnetic interference disrupting IoT sensors
- Structural fatigue from constant wave impacts
Material Science Breakthroughs Behind Certification
DNVGL-RP standards mandate triple-layer protection systems:
- Hydrogen-induced cracking (HIC) resistant alloys
- Pressurized nitrogen chambers
- Smart corrosion monitoring sensors
Feature | Traditional | DNVGL-RP Certified |
---|---|---|
Lifespan | 5-7 years | 12+ years |
Maintenance Intervals | Quarterly | Biannual |
Failure Rate | 22% | 3.8% |
Implementation Strategies for Maximum ROI
Norway’s Troll Field achieved 94% operational uptime through:
- Phased retrofitting of legacy systems
- Real-time thickness monitoring via ultrasonic arrays
- Customized ventilation balancing humidity control
